Grace Institute’s employer-driven workforce training programs help women develop the professional skills employers have identified as being needed by today’s administrative and customer service professionals. We offer two hybrid programs: Office Administration Program and Office Administration Program

Office Administration Program

Helps women gain employment in a variety of industries, with a curriculum that includes:

  • Office Technology: Outlook, Word, Excel, PowerPoint and Google Suite
  • Administration: calendaring and scheduling, coordinating travel arrangements, project management, budgeting and expense reports
  • Verbal and non-verbal communication
  • Professional Skills: problem solving; time management; working in teams, workplace etiquette, managing up
  • Job Search: cover letter and resume support, LinkedIn profile, and interviewing skills

Healthcare Administration Program

Helps women gain employment in the healthcare field as an administrator, with a curriculum that includes:

  • Medical office administration: managing phone calls/messages, scheduling appointments, clinic prep/reconciliation, handling difficult interactions, insurance documentation, electronic health record, EPIC
  • Supporting patients
  • Job search: cover letter and resume support, LinkedIn profile, and interviewing skills
  • Office technology: Outlook, Word, Excel and Google Suite
